Bitcoin vs. N95 Masks: A Comparative Analysis of Value and Utility242
The question, "Bitcoin or N95 masks?" might seem absurd at first glance. One is a decentralized digital currency, the other a crucial piece of personal protective equipment (PPE). However, framing the comparison around their relative value and utility offers a fascinating insight into the diverse ways we assess worth in a rapidly changing world. While seemingly disparate, both Bitcoin and N95 masks have experienced periods of intense price volatility, demonstrate fluctuating demand driven by external factors, and ultimately represent a form of investment or protection, albeit vastly different in nature.
Let's begin by analyzing the inherent value proposition of each. An N95 mask, a specific type of respirator, offers immediate, tangible protection against airborne particles, including viruses and bacteria. Its value is intrinsically linked to its function – preventing illness and saving lives. Its worth is directly tied to its efficacy in mitigating health risks during a pandemic or other health crisis. The demand for N95 masks spikes drastically during outbreaks, reflecting its crucial role in public health. The price, while often subject to market fluctuations driven by supply chain issues or speculation, fundamentally remains anchored to its life-saving utility.
Bitcoin, on the other hand, operates on a different plane. Its value is not tied to a physical commodity or a readily apparent utility in the same way an N95 mask is. Its worth is largely derived from its scarcity (a fixed supply of 21 million coins), its perceived security through cryptographic techniques, and, crucially, the collective belief in its future value. This makes Bitcoin a highly speculative asset, susceptible to dramatic price swings influenced by market sentiment, regulatory changes, technological advancements, and even social media trends. Its utility lies primarily in its potential as a store of value, a medium of exchange, or a tool for financial transactions outside traditional banking systems.
The comparison becomes more nuanced when we consider the context of risk and reward. Investing in N95 masks during a pandemic, for example, could yield significant profits if you correctly anticipate a shortage. However, the risk lies in potential oversupply, obsolescence (new and improved masks), or the pandemic ending prematurely. The reward is primarily financial, albeit potentially ethically questionable if profiteering from a public health crisis is involved. Similarly, investing in Bitcoin carries substantial risk. Its price can plummet dramatically, wiping out substantial investments. The reward, however, could be exponentially higher than the initial investment if the cryptocurrency maintains or increases its value over time.
One key difference lies in the tangible nature of each asset. An N95 mask is a physical object with verifiable properties. Its quality can be assessed and its effectiveness tested. Bitcoin, on the other hand, is intangible. Its value is entirely dependent on trust in the underlying technology, the blockchain, and the community that supports it. This lack of tangible existence introduces a layer of complexity and uncertainty to Bitcoin investment.
Furthermore, the regulatory landscapes differ significantly. N95 masks are subject to various safety regulations and standards, ensuring a minimum level of quality and performance. The regulatory environment for Bitcoin varies considerably across jurisdictions. Some countries actively embrace cryptocurrencies, while others impose strict regulations or outright bans, adding further uncertainty to its value and usability.
In terms of accessibility, N95 masks, while facing supply chain issues at times, are generally more accessible than Bitcoin. Accessing Bitcoin requires technical knowledge, a suitable digital wallet, and navigating the often-complex world of cryptocurrency exchanges. This creates a barrier to entry that significantly limits its accessibility compared to a readily available, albeit potentially overpriced, N95 mask.
Ultimately, the "better" choice between Bitcoin and an N95 mask depends entirely on individual circumstances, risk tolerance, and investment goals. An N95 mask offers immediate, tangible protection against a specific threat. Its value is primarily utilitarian. Bitcoin, on the other hand, presents a far riskier, yet potentially more rewarding, long-term investment opportunity. Its value is largely speculative and depends on complex market forces and future adoption.
The comparison highlights the fundamental differences between investment in tangible assets with clear utility (like PPE) and intangible, speculative assets (like cryptocurrencies). While both can yield profits or provide protection, their risk profiles, accessibility, and underlying value propositions differ drastically. The choice between Bitcoin and an N95 mask isn't about which is "better," but rather about understanding the distinct risks and rewards associated with each and making a well-informed decision based on your individual needs and priorities.
